About the Role
Reporting to the National Enterprise Portfolio Manager, you'll be responsible for providing assurance and enablement across the organisation's enterprise project portfolio.
You'll play a critical role in :
Conducting quality assurance across the project and programme lifecycle
Supporting and advising delivery teams across the organisation
Preparing governance reporting and papers
Ensuring strategic alignment and prioritisation of the portfolio
Championing benefits realisation, lessons learnt, and continuous improvement
Coaching, mentoring and uplifting capability across programme and project teams
This is a hands-on role requiring someone who can work independently and collaboratively, with a customer-focused, solutions-oriented approach.
About You
You'll bring a strong background in portfolio, programme, or project management, with a depth of experience in complex, multi-stakeholder environments.
You're comfortable operating at both strategic and operational levels.
You'll Ideally Have
10+ years' experience in programme / project delivery or portfolio assurance
Expertise in portfolio governance, quality assurance, and benefits management
Proven capability mentoring and guiding delivery teams
Experience with Better Business Cases, Investment Confidence Ratings, and P3M3
Excellent communication and relationship-building skills
A strong understanding of te ao Maori and Treaty obligations (or a commitment to developing this)
Qualifications in PRINCE2, MSP or other recognised methodologies are desirable.
